Fakhar Zaman Stars as Lahore Qalandars Crush Peshawar Zalmi to Revive PSL Playoff Hopes, Bracewell’s 83 Proves Futile

Lahore Qalandars Strike Back in High-Stakes PSL Clash

In a pulsating contest that had Pakistani cricket fans on the edge of their seats, Lahore Qalandars delivered a crucial win against Peshawar Zalmi. This victory has injected fresh life into their campaign for a playoff spot in the Pakistan Super League.

The match showcased the intense competition typical of the PSL, where every point counts towards qualification.

Zaman Emerges as the Hero for Qalandars

Fakhar Zaman proved to be the standout performer, steering his team to triumph with a decisive contribution. His efforts ensured that Lahore Qalandars could celebrate a hard-fought success, directly addressing their precarious position in the points table.

Bracewell’s Fighting 83 Not Enough for Peshawar Zalmi

Despite a gritty 83 from Michael Bracewell, Peshawar Zalmi could not defend their total. This substantial knock highlighted Bracewell’s skill under pressure, yet it failed to secure the points needed for his side.

An innings of 83 in T20 cricket represents a significant effort, often capable of setting challenging targets or mounting chases. However, on this occasion, it went in vain as Qalandars’ batsmen rose to the challenge.

Peshawar Zalmi’s loss has left their qualification scenario hanging by a thread, with results now dependent on upcoming fixtures and net run rates.
